Wideband Power Amplifiers: Does Increasing Bandwidth Always Mean Lower Efficiency?
2025-08-05
In modern RF system design, achieving wide bandwidth, high output power, and high efficiency simultaneously remains a significant engineering challenge.
While amplifiers can be optimized for efficiency over narrow frequency ranges, extending performance across an octave or more often leads to issues such as:
· Significant efficiency drop-off at band edges
· Increased thermal management demands
· Stricter linearity and stability requirements
· Difficulty maintaining performance without bulky matching networks
These challenges are particularly critical in aerospace, electronic warfare, and broadband test systems.
Understanding and addressing these trade-offs is essential for advancing RF power amplifier technology, especially in demanding applications.

Low Power, Long Range: Narrowband RF Power Amplifiers in Smart Cities
As smart cities evolve, efficient, automated infrastructure is key to improving urban management and residents’ quality of life. Applications like smart street lighting, waste management, environmental monitoring, and public safety are driving demand for low-power, long-range communication. Narrowband RF power amplifiers (RF PAs), with their low power consumption and long range, are crucial in meeting these needs.
